Job Description:

HMRC's Risk and Intelligence Service (RIS) collects, integrates and analyses one of the largest and most diverse range of data and intelligence in the world. This enables HMRC to understand and manage risks associated with non-compliance with the UK tax system.

We are looking for Senior Data Analysts with genuine passion for analytics and an innovative mind-set and the ability to lead others.

Your job will involve the following:

  • Leading on our technical standards of analysis, taking responsibility for our analytical products
  • Using advanced analytical skills to design and deliver products that identify individuals, businesses and customer behaviours of greatest risk to the UK economy
  • Manipulating large datasets, assuring and optimising analytics and statistical modelling
  • Translating complex analytics for a non-technical audience
  • Training and mentoring small teams of data analysts
  • Building capability within our analytical community, developing effective and efficient working processes

You will need the following skills and experience:

  • Delivering complex analytics projects
  • Using a range of cutting-edge analytical tools and software to manipulate complex datasets
  • Using analytical software such as SAS Enterprise Guide
  • Coding languages including SAS, SQL, R or similar
  • Developing, implementing, maintaining and reviewing systems and services
  • Identifying risks and resolving issues
  • Involving colleagues, stakeholders and delivery partners in developing suggestions for improvements
  • Confident presentational skills
  • Working with non-analytical stakeholders
